Tobropt eye drops are a topical antibiotic solution used to treat various bacterial eye infections. The active ingredient, tobramycin, belongs to the aminoglycoside class of antibiotics, known for their effectiveness against a broad spectrum of bacteria. This means it can tackle a wide range of microorganisms commonly responsible for eye infections.
The medication comes in a convenient 5ml bottle, dispensing as individual drops. Its formulation includes additional components like boric acid and sodium chloride to maintain stability and eye compatibility. It’s important to note that Tobropt contains benzalkonium chloride, a preservative that may cause mild eye irritation in some individuals, and can alter the color of soft contact lenses. Always remove contact lenses before application.

Tobropt’s effectiveness stems from its active ingredient, tobramycin, an aminoglycoside antibiotic. This powerful medication works by targeting the protein synthesis machinery within bacterial cells. Specifically, tobramycin binds to the 30S ribosomal subunit, a crucial component in the process of building proteins essential for bacterial survival.
By disrupting this vital process, tobramycin effectively inhibits bacterial growth. At lower concentrations, this action is primarily bacteriostatic, meaning it stops the bacteria from multiplying. However, at higher concentrations, tobramycin exhibits a bactericidal effect, directly killing the bacteria. This dual action contributes to its broad efficacy against a variety of bacterial strains.
This targeted mechanism of action ensures that tobramycin primarily affects bacterial cells, minimizing the risk of harming healthy human cells. This selective targeting is a key factor in the relative safety and effectiveness of Tobropt in treating bacterial eye infections. The localized application further enhances this targeted effect.
Tobropt eye drops are primarily indicated for the treatment of bacterial infections affecting the eye. These infections can manifest in various forms, causing significant discomfort and potentially impacting vision. Prompt and appropriate treatment is crucial to prevent complications and ensure a swift recovery.
Common conditions effectively treated with Tobropt include conjunctivitis (pink eye), blepharitis (inflammation of the eyelids), and keratitis (inflammation of the cornea). It may also be used to treat other bacterial infections of the eye such as blepharoconjunctivitis and keratoconjunctivitis. The broad spectrum of activity of tobramycin makes it effective against many bacterial culprits.
In addition to treating existing infections, Tobropt can also play a preventative role. It’s often used prophylactically in ophthalmic surgery to reduce the risk of post-operative infections. This preventative measure helps ensure a smoother recovery process and minimizes the chances of complications following surgical procedures.

The recommended dosage of Tobropt varies depending on the severity of the infection and the doctor’s assessment. Generally, for mild to moderate infections, the typical regimen involves instilling one to two drops into the affected eye(s) every four hours. Always adhere to your doctor’s specific instructions.
In cases of more severe infections, more frequent administration may be necessary. Your ophthalmologist might recommend applying the drops as often as every 30 minutes to an hour initially, gradually reducing the frequency as the infection improves. This more aggressive approach helps to quickly control the infection.
Proper administration is crucial for effectiveness. Before instilling the drops, ensure your hands are clean. Gently pull down your lower eyelid to create a pocket, and then apply the drops into this pocket. Avoid touching the tip of the bottle to your eye or any other surface to maintain sterility. After application, gently close your eyelids for a few seconds to allow the medication to distribute evenly.

Before using Tobropt, it’s crucial to discuss your medical history with your doctor. This includes any allergies you may have, particularly to aminoglycoside antibiotics or other medications. This precaution helps prevent potential allergic reactions or interactions with other drugs you might be taking.
Pregnant or breastfeeding women should also consult their physician before using Tobropt. While generally considered safe, the use during pregnancy or breastfeeding requires careful consideration and potential adjustments to the treatment plan. Your doctor can assess the risks and benefits for your specific situation.
If you wear contact lenses, remove them before applying Tobropt and wait at least fifteen minutes before reinserting them. This is because the preservative benzalkonium chloride can interact with the lenses. Following these instructions helps avoid complications and ensures the medication’s effectiveness.
While generally well-tolerated, Tobropt can cause some side effects in a small percentage of users. These are usually mild and temporary, resolving once treatment is stopped. However, it’s essential to be aware of these possibilities and to contact your doctor if you experience any concerning symptoms.
The most common side effect is transient burning or stinging upon application. This is often related to the preservative, benzalkonium chloride. Other potential side effects include eye redness, itching, and a feeling of dryness. These are typically mild and subside quickly.
In rare cases, more serious allergic reactions can occur. These might manifest as severe eye irritation, swelling, or difficulty breathing. If you experience any serious side effects, stop using Tobropt immediately and seek medical attention. Prompt action is crucial in such cases.
Before using Tobropt, it’s vital to inform your doctor about all medications you are currently taking, including over-the-counter drugs and supplements. This is crucial to avoid potential interactions that could affect the effectiveness of Tobropt or increase the risk of side effects. Transparency with your doctor is paramount.
If you have a history of allergies, particularly to aminoglycoside antibiotics, discuss this with your doctor before starting treatment. Allergic reactions, though rare, can be serious. This preemptive discussion helps ensure your safety and allows for informed decision-making.
Do not use Tobropt if you suspect a fungal or viral infection of the eye. This medication is only effective against bacterial infections. Incorrect use could delay proper treatment and potentially worsen the condition. Always seek a proper diagnosis from your ophthalmologist.

To ensure the efficacy and safety of Tobropt, proper storage is essential. Store the bottle in a cool, dry place, away from direct sunlight or extreme temperatures. Ideal storage conditions are between 15°C and 25°C (59°F and 77°F), as specified by the manufacturer.
Keep the bottle tightly capped to prevent contamination and maintain sterility. Avoid exposing the solution to excessive heat or freezing temperatures, as this can compromise its effectiveness. Always check the expiration date printed on the packaging.
Once the expiration date has passed, discard the remaining medication. Using expired eye drops can be risky and might not provide the intended therapeutic benefit. Always prioritize using fresh, unexpired medication for optimal results and to minimize any potential risks.
While Tobropt is generally effective, it’s crucial to complete the full course of treatment prescribed by your doctor, even if symptoms improve before the medication runs out. Stopping early can lead to the persistence of the infection or the development of antibiotic resistance.
If your symptoms worsen or don’t improve after a few days of using Tobropt, consult your ophthalmologist. They may need to adjust the treatment plan or investigate the possibility of a different type of infection. Don’t hesitate to seek further medical advice if needed.
Remember that Tobropt is a topical antibiotic and only treats bacterial infections. It’s ineffective against viral or fungal eye infections. Accurate diagnosis is crucial for choosing the right treatment. Always consult your healthcare professional for proper diagnosis and treatment.
